Chronic Lymphoedema due to Lymphatic Filariasis

Inclusion criteria
Inclusion criteria: 1. Age > 14 years and 40 kg 5. Lymphedema of a limb Grade 1-6 measured on a 7-point scale (Dreyer G et al. 2002). 6. Ability to use established standardized methods of hygiene and effectively applying it prior to the initiation of the drug treatment 7. No evidence of severe or systemic co-morbidities except for features of filarial disease 8. Normal laboratory profile 9. Consent to storage of blood samples for study
Exclusion criteria
Exclusion criteria: 1. No lymphedema or lymphedema stage 7 2. Age 65 years 3. Body weight < 40 kg 4. Pregnant or breastfeeding women 5. Women of childbearing potential not using an agreed method of contraception. (A pregnancy test will be conducted as part of the screening process to exclude pregnancy and repeated at 3 and 8 weeks. In addition, women of childbearing potential will be counseled against pregnancy during the treatment period) 6. Clinical or laboratory evidence of hepatic or renal dysfunction or CNS disease 7. Alcohol or drug abuse 8. History of adverse reactions to doxycycline or other tetracyclines 9. Patient has any situation or condition that may interfere with participation in the study as judged by the clinical investigator 10. Chronic headache and current headache 11. Persons who are currently taking doxycycline for other indications 12. Lymphedema due to post-radiation, post-surgical and primary (congenital) lymphedema
Design outcomes
Primary
| Measure | Time frame |
|---|---|
| Change in lymphedema grade at 24 months compared to baseline [At baseline and 24 months after commencement of the intervention] | — |
Secondary
| Measure | Time frame |
|---|---|
| Improvement or halt of progression (Lack of progression) of LE when examined 12 months after treatment onset [At baseline, 12 months and 24 months after commencement of the intervention] Improvement of LE when examined 12 and 24 months after treatment onset [At baseline, 12 months and 24 months after commencement of the intervention] Change of LE stages (reduction or increase) compared to baseline assessed at 12 and 24 months [At baseline, 12 months and 24 months after commencement of the intervention ] Change in the circumference of the affected limb from baseline [At baseline, 12 months and 24 months after commencement of the intervention ] Change in circumference through Lymphatech 3D-camera measurement compared to baseline [At baseline, 12 months and 24 months after commencement of the intervention ] Change in volume through Lymphatech 3D-camera measurements compared to baseline [At baseline, 12 months and 24 months after commencement of the intervention ] Reduction in the frequency of acute ADLA attacks evaluated from 0-12 months and from 12-24 months after treatment onset [At baseline, 12 months and 24 months after commencement of the intervention ] Changes in skin thickness at 12 and 24 months compared to the baseline [At baseline, 12 months and 24 months after commencement of the intervention ] Change in angiogenic, pro-fibrotic or pro-inflammatory biomarkers at 12 and 24 months following doxycycline administration (at sites where these tests are done) [At baseline, 12 months and 24 months after commencement of the intervention ] | — |
